How much do entry level 45k j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 24, 2026, the average yearly pay for entry level 45k in the United States is $48,812.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$44,000.00 and $53,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the 70 30 rule in hiring?

The 70/30 rule in hiring suggests that 70% of the hiring decision should be based on skills, experience, and qualifications, while 30% should consider cultural fit and soft skills. For entry-level roles like an Entry Level 45K position, this emphasizes assessing both technical ability and interpersonal qualities during the interview process.

How to make $50,000 a year without a degree?

Entry-level jobs that pay around $45,000 annually often include roles such as sales associate, administrative assistant, or technician, which typically require strong communication skills, basic technical knowledge, or certifications rather than a degree. Gaining relevant skills through on-the-job training, certifications, or apprenticeships can help increase earning potential to reach $50,000 or more. Building experience and developing specialized skills in high-demand areas like technology, trades, or sales can also improve salary prospects without a college degree.
